Ok now I'm embarassed, I let a cavalier beat me. We both came off a light and I got out in front at first but after about a hundred feet he got away from me. So I guess it is time to do some engine mods. I have a 2000 CC 4X4 4.7L (stock engine) What are suggestions for my first first purchase? Keeping in mind $ to HP being very important due to my limited budget. Any suggestions would be greatly appreciated.

Hey guy, I dont have a Dakota yet but I will have one soon. But I do know that some of the more effective mods are your intake, headers, and exhast. Be it Airade, K&N, or Intimitator; flowmaster, borla, or gibson; edelbrock, JBA, or mopar performance. One suggestion would be www.speedtweeks.com. In their performance kits section there are 4 kits from $500 to $1300. The best value will probably be kit 3. It has the intake, a TB, tstat, headers, and exhast. So shop around for the best price, but thats what to look for.

Skip the Headers if you are on a limited budget. Go for the gibson cat back and due a self made intake with a K&N cone. That alone is only about $300 to $400 total. Also get the IAT adjuster from speedtweaks - $35 Depending on your driving habits and climate, you can do 180 T-Stat($8) and remove the mechanical fan(free). Set of 5224 Autolites are about $8 and I know a blind monkey who can install plugs, not very tough. A DOHC head with a 6 inch recess, a little different. Was the Cavalier modified? After my "dak" (sorry i mean DAKOTA so were all on the same page here) i picked up a 92 Intergra rs from my buddy, when i got it from him it had an LS (1.8l NON-VTEC BLOCK) with a b16 head (1.6l vtec head). it had 10.5:1 pistons for a total compression of 10.8:1, the b16 head adds .3 to an ls block. The head was stuffed with a complete Type R valvetrain including intake manifold and a 54mm throttle body, thats stuff plus a fuel pressure regulator and a Skunkworks ECU.

That combo was good enough to blow the doors off my dak. the car revved to about 9000+rpm with peak hp about 8500 and was good for mid-high 13's on the street.
